The medical word for jock itch is tinea ________

A) corporis
B) pedis
C) cruris
D) capitus


C
Explanation: A) Tinea corporis is not known as jock itch.
B) Tinea pedis is athlete's foot, not jock itch.
C) Correct! Tinea cruris, or jock itch, is a fungal infection in the skin of the groin.
D) Tinea capitis is a fungal infection on the scalp.
